Why Solar Google Ads Leads Are Uniquely Time-Sensitive

Solar is a considered purchase with a long research phase - but there is a critical window when the homeowner transitions from "researching" to "ready to talk." That transition happens the moment they submit a Google Ads form. They have moved from passively reading about solar to actively requesting quotes. In that moment, they are comparing your company to 2-4 other installers they found on the same search results page.

The solar industry has notoriously slow lead response times. Companies like SolarReviews and EnergySage route leads to multiple installers, creating a race to respond. Even with exclusive Google Ads leads, the homeowner has likely clicked multiple ads and submitted multiple forms. The installer who calls first, qualifies professionally, and books a site assessmentwins the deal.

Research from Lead Connect shows that 78% of customers buy from the first company that responds helpfully. For solar installations averaging $20,000-35,000, losing a deal because your sales rep was on another call is extremely expensive.

The Solar Lead Qualification Challenge

Not every solar lead is a good fit. Solar companies waste significant time on leads that do not qualify - renters, homeowners with heavily shaded roofs, people with low electricity bills, or those with poor credit for financing. Manual qualification takes your sales team 15-30 minutes per lead, and by then, qualified leads have cooled off.

AI calling solves both problems simultaneously: it responds instantly (speed) and qualifies in real-time (efficiency). Unqualified leads are filtered out in 2 minutes instead of consuming 30 minutes of a sales rep's day.

What the AI Asks Solar Leads

As demonstrated in the video above, the AI conducts a focused qualification conversation:

  1. Homeownership: Do you own your home? (Renters cannot install solar)
  2. Roof condition and type: Approximate age of roof, material type, any known issues
  3. Electricity usage: Average monthly electricity bill (to estimate system size and savings)
  4. Shading: Any large trees or obstructions on the south-facing roof area
  5. Timeline: When are you looking to make a decision?
  6. Financing preference: Cash purchase, loan, lease, or PPA
  7. Scheduling: Books a site assessment or virtual consultation based on availability

Your sales team receives a pre-qualified lead with complete details and a booked appointment. They walk into the consultation knowing the homeowner's electricity costs, roof situation, financing preference, and timeline.

Evening and Weekend Leads: Where Solar Revenue Hides

Solar research happens primarily during evenings and weekends. Homeowners review their electricity bills after dinner, research solar panels on Saturday mornings, and compare installer quotes on Sunday afternoons. According to industry data, 40-55% of solar Google Ads leads submit forms outside of standard business hours.

Without AI, every one of those leads waits until Monday morning (or later). With AI calling, a homeowner who submits a form at 8 PM on Saturday gets an instant callback, answers qualification questions, and books a Tuesday site assessment - all while still in "research mode" and before they have moved on to other priorities.

Google Ads Keywords That Convert Best With AI Callback

Certain solar keywords benefit disproportionately from instant AI response:

  • High-intent transactional: "solar installation quotes [city]," "solar panel cost," "solar installers near me" - these leads are comparing options right now
  • Incentive-driven: "solar tax credit 2026," "solar rebates [state]" - homeowners motivated by expiring incentives, urgent timeline
  • Bill-reduction: "reduce electricity bill," "solar savings calculator" - cost-motivated, need quick ROI conversation
  • Financing-specific: "$0 down solar," "solar financing options" - ready to move forward if financing works

For all of these, the searcher is actively evaluating. A 60-second callback catches them at peak intent. A 3-hour callback catches them after they have already spoken to two other installers.

ROI Math for Solar Google Ads + AI Calling

Consider a solar company spending $10,000/month on Google Ads:

  • Cost per lead: $70
  • Leads per month: 143
  • Current response time: 4 hours average
  • Current site assessment booking rate: 18%
  • Close rate from assessments: 25%
  • Average installation value: $28,000

Current revenue: 143 leads × 18% assessments × 25% close = ~6.4 deals × $28,000 = $179,000/month.

With AI instant response (conservative 2x improvement in assessment booking rate):

  • 143 leads × 36% assessments × 25% close = ~12.9 deals × $28,000 = $361,000/month
  • Net improvement: +$182,000/month from the same $10,000 ad spend

Even a conservative 50% improvement in booking rate would add multiple six-figure installations per month. One additional solar installation more than justifies the investment in AI calling.
